2012 Eating Recovery Center Foundation Eating Disorders Conference Features Nation’s Leading Experts

Registration Now Open for Educational Conference for Professionals Showcasing Innovative Eating Disorders Treatment Strategies, Highlighting Trends and Addressing Upcoming Changes in the Field

Denver, CO, July 03, 2012 – Denver, Colo., has emerged as a national hub for the treatment of eating disorders. This August, the experts who elevated Denver to this status, along with a group of other highly regarded professionals, will gather in the Mile High City to share trends, new research and emerging best practices in the field of eating disorders treatment at the 4th Annual Eating Recovery Center Foundation Eating Disorders Conference. Formerly known as the Rocky Mountain Eating Disorders Conference, the event will be held August 10-11, 2012, and is hosted by the Eating Recovery Center Foundation, a non-profit organization established to promote education, research and patient access to treatment.

“In the eating disorders field, it is imperative that we share resources, best practices and promising research in order to help our patients achieve the best outcomes possible,” said Kenneth L. Weiner, MD, FAED, CEDS, chief executive officer and founding partner of Eating Recovery Center, an international center for eating disorders recovery. “The Eating Recovery Center Foundation Eating Disorders Conference is a forum in which professionals and advocates alike can learn from each other, collaborate and share the innovative practices that are moving our field forward.”

This interactive educational program features plenary speakers, panel discussions and Q&A sessions, and supports connection and collaboration among attending physicians, therapists, nurses, dietitians, advocacy organizations and other members of the eating disorders treatment community. Highlights of the 2012 eating disorders conference include:

* Eating Disorders in the DSM-V: What Might We Expect?; Joel Yager, MD, FAED

* Acceptance and Commitment Therapy in Action; Enola Gorham, LCSW, CEDS

* The State of Evidence-Based Treatment in the Field of Eating Disorders; Craig Johnson, PhD, FAED, CEDS

* Updates in Refeeding Practices for Adolescents with Anorexia in the Inpatient Setting; Ovidio Bermudez, MD, FAED, FSAHM, FAAP, CEDS

* Cognitive Remediation Therapy for Eating Disorders: A New Adjunct to Treatment; Emmett Bishop, MD, FAED, CEDS

The 2012 Eating Recovery Center Foundation Eating Disorders Conference will again be held at the Denver Marriott City Center. This year, Eating Recovery Center will also offer conference attendees the opportunity to attend a pre-conference four-hour ethics workshop. Titled “Should Gandhi Have Been Force Fed: Ethical Issues in the Treatment of Eating Disorders,” the workshop will be held Friday, August 10, from 8:30 a.m. to 12:30 p.m., prior to the start of the general conference. Presenters include eating disorders treatment expert Craig Johnson, PhD, FAED, CEDS, chief clinical officer of Eating Recovery Center; Rev. David W. Kenney, MA, MA, Cand. D.Be., of The Clinical Ethics Consultancy; and Andrew Braun, MBA, chief operating officer of Eating Recovery Center. The new Eating Recovery Center Foundation (ERCF) was established in 2012 as a 501(c)(3) foundation with a three-fold purpose: to provide professionals in the eating disorders field with education and development programs that increase their knowledge and strengthen clinical treatment skills; to support research initiatives that deepen our understanding of these illnesses and how they can best be treated; and to create a fund that provides financial grants to Eating Recovery Center patients who require financial assistance.

About Eating Recovery Center
Eating Recovery Center is an international center for eating disorders recovery providing comprehensive treatment for anorexia, bulimia, EDNOS and binge eating disorder. Under the personal guidance and care of Drs. Kenneth Weiner, Craig Johnson, Emmett Bishop and Ovidio Bermudez, programs provide a full spectrum of services for children, adolescents and adults that includes Inpatient, Residential, Partial Hospitalization, Intensive Outpatient and Outpatient Services. Our compassionate team of professionals collaborates with treating professionals and loved ones to cultivate lasting behavioral change. Denver-based facilities include the Behavioral Hospital for Adults, the Behavioral Hospital for Children and Adolescents, the Partial Hospitalization Program and Outpatient Services for Adults, and the Partial Hospitalization Program for Children and Adolescents. In addition, Eating Recovery Center, partnering with Summit Eating Disorders and Outreach Program, offers Partial Hospitalization and Outpatient Services in Sacramento, California, as well as Intensive Outpatient and Outpatient Services in Fresno and Roseville.
